WARNING - Cont Keep hands away from wheels when jacking up truck. Wheels may turn as they clear the gound. Personnel can be injured. When working on truck springs, keep body clear of underside of spring. When parts are taken off, spring may come out and cause injury. Truck springs are under tension. Use C-clamp to hold spring together when taking it apart. Truck springs are heavy. Make sure spring does not fall and cause injury to person- nel and damage to equipment. Clean hands carefully after using anti-seize compound. It contains lead and even small amounts will cause serious illness. Do not use a wire brush or compressed air to clean brake drums. There may be as- bestos dust on the drums which can be dangerous to your health. b
